Sitting out in a canoe in January is crazy! But as I was stuck on the island all weekend I snuck out hoping for some chironomid action at the local year-round lake...Saturday despite many little silvers rising I hooked up only once, and promptly lost it...plenty of midges coming off for a bit there...as the wind blew me around in circles crazily and made a nice flat line impossible...Sunday the temps cooled and the wind was a little less gusty but only had one bite and missed it. Saw three chironomids. Never did see a fish that looked bigger than about 8"...I hope we get another shot of warm weather in a couple of weeks, because I really want to hook a fish on a dry fly in January!
